Functioni
Required for maintaining the appropriate mycolic acid composition and permeability of the envelope on its exposure to acidic pH. Upon expression in E.coli functions as a triacylglycerol synthase, making triacylglycerol (TG) from diolein and long-chain fatty acyl-CoA. Has very weak wax synthase activity, incorporating palmityl alcohol into wax esters in the presence of palmitoyl-CoA.2 Publications

Pathology & Biotechi
Disruption phenotypei
Inactivation of the mymA operon causes altered cell wall structure, reduced contents and altered composition of mycolic acids along with the accumulation of saturated C24 and C26 fatty acids, and enhanced susceptibility to antibiotics, detergents and acidic pH. Also impairs ability to survive in macrophages.2 Publications

Expressioni
Inductioni
Expression is controlled by VirS. Induced at acidic pH and in macrophages. Induced by low levels of nitric oxide (NO), but not by hypoxia.2 Publications
